A unique product that offers total washroom and toilet care.

Its fiercely effective, yet gentle action removes lime, hard water scale, rust and waste products from all washroom surfaces and is also suitable to cleaning tiled floors.

Due to the neutral citrus acids, it is not suitable for use on marble, limestone, granite or other stone surfaces.

Contains coconut-based detergents and citrus oils.

  • Endorsed with the Good Environmental Choice Australia (GECA) mark.
  • Eliminates the need for multiple bathroom cleaning products.
  • Great for removing bore water marks from showers.
  • Offers a lasting lime freshness that destroys odours.
  • Soap scum and body fats are effortlessly removed.

Application:

Toilets and Urinals - Use neat

  1. Apply via squeeze bottle or trigger spray.
  2. Allow the clinging action to activate and lightly brush or leave overnight without brushing.
  3. Pay attention to under the rim where most odours and stains come from.
  4. Deeply marked stainless steel urinals may require agitation with a white scour to remove heavy build-up.
  5. Rinse thoroughly with water.

Showers and heavily built–up soap and scum – Use Neat

  1. First apply to the floor of the shower then the walls.
  2. Allow 5 minutes for the cleaning action to work.
  3. Lightly agitate with an Oates white scour and rinse with water.

Walls, sinks and fixtures - 1 to 10 parts water

  1. Dilute as directed.
  2. Apply with a foam gun or sponge mop the surface to remove build-up from tiles and grout.
  3. Wipe fixtures with a clean cloth or towelling.

Floors - 1 to 50 parts water (200ml per 10L)

  1. Dilute as directed.
  2. Mop over the surface. If needed allow solution to soak for a few minutes.
  3. Dry mop off.
